Concrete Kings Clash: Ozinga Brothers’ Court Fight Rocks Chicago Empire

In Chicago’s concrete world, the usually buttoned‑up Ozinga clan is suddenly in open conflict. Two brothers have hauled their siblings and the company’s CEO into court, alleging leadership cut corners to rush a roughly $50 million acquisition and threatening to upend control of the near‑100‑year‑old family business.

First-time candidate Liam Stanton launches bid for Chicago mayor

Liam Stanton, a 38-year-old tech entrepreneur and small business owner from Rogers Park, has officially launched his bid for Mayor of Chicago, focusing on safety, affordability, and growth.
